Output e67e1a469b57b8ad68a9c23537ea7ffd083cb519a57a2e9548c3acdf6001bb2a:105

value
16753663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2fe45157e0037cdb7ec9de7696e71b8caf3763c OP_EQUAL
address
3KU3cjnDPW7L1pVmk8fFZaC9gb5Q3qiTdJ
transaction
e67e1a469b57b8ad68a9c23537ea7ffd083cb519a57a2e9548c3acdf6001bb2a
confirmations
262061
spent
true